Udostępnij za pośrednictwem


Przycisk na pasku poleceń ma nieprawidłowe etykiety lub tłumaczenia

W tym artykule rozwiązano problem z nieprawidłową etykietą lub tłumaczeniem za pomocą nowoczesnego lub klasycznego przycisku polecenia w usłudze Microsoft Power Apps.

Nowoczesne polecenia

Możesz dostosować etykiety i tworzyć tłumaczenia dla nowoczesnych poleceń tak samo jak w przypadku formularzy i tabel. Jeśli nowoczesne polecenie wyświetla niepoprawny tekst, jego etykieta może nie zostać poprawnie skonfigurowana.

Sprawdź, czy w rozwiązaniu znajdują się poprawne tłumaczenia

Eksportuj tłumaczenia dla rozwiązania, które zawiera nowoczesne polecenie. Otwórz plik XML i sprawdź, czy etykieta ma poprawne tłumaczenia.

Poniższy zrzut ekranu przedstawia plik tłumaczenia otwarty w programie Microsoft Excel. Ostatnie trzy wiersze są przeznaczone dla opisu, etykietki narzędzia i etykiety nowoczesnego polecenia. W dwóch ostatnich kolumnach pokazano tekst używany odpowiednio dla identyfikatorów LCID 1033 i 2052, odpowiadający angielski (Stany Zjednoczone) i chiński uproszczony (Chiny).

Zrzut ekranu przedstawia przykład pliku tłumaczenia.

Sprawdzanie warstw rozwiązania

Jeśli w pliku tłumaczenia znajduje się poprawny tekst, mogą istnieć inne rozwiązania, które go zastępują. Wyświetl warstwy rozwiązania dla etykiety , aby sprawdzić, czy istnieje tekst zdefiniowany dla tej samej etykiety w wyższym rozwiązaniu.

Polecenia klasyczne

Etykiety i tłumaczenia dla poleceń klasycznych można dostosować, dodając je do <RibbonDiffXml> elementu pliku customization.xml i importując plik XML do rozwiązania.

Sprawdź, czy istnieją poprawne tłumaczenia

  1. Włącz moduł sprawdzania poleceń i wybierz przycisk polecenia, aby sprawdzić.

  2. W okienku po prawej stronie przedstawiono cztery rodzaje tekstu, które można dostosować dla przycisku polecenia.

    Zrzut ekranu przedstawia tekst, który można dostosować dla przycisku polecenia.

    • Alt: etykieta używana przez czytniki zawartości ekranu.
    • LabelText: etykieta wyświetlana dla przycisku polecenia.
    • ToolTipTitle: nagłówek etykietki narzędzia przycisku polecenia.
    • ToolTipDescription: tekst treści etykietki narzędzia przycisku polecenia.

    W przypadku problemów z etykietą przycisku odpowiednia właściwość to LabelText.

  3. W dolnej części właściwości tekstowej wybierz pozycję Wyświetl warstwy rozwiązania etykiet. Ta opcja nie będzie wyświetlana, jeśli tekst nie został dostosowany.

    Zrzut ekranu przedstawia opcję Wyświetl warstwy rozwiązania etykiet.

    Uwaga 16.

    Niektóre dostosowania etykiet dla poleceń systemowych nie są używane <RibbonDiffXml> i dlatego nie można przeprowadzić inspekcji w narzędziu sprawdzania poleceń.

  4. Zostaną wyświetlone rozwiązania dostosowane do tekstu. W tym przykładzie tylko jedno rozwiązanie ma dostosowany element LabelText.

    Zrzut ekranu przedstawia rozwiązanie, które dostosować tekst.

  5. Wybierz rozwiązanie, aby wyświetlić wszystkie zawarte w nim tłumaczenia LocLabel . Sprawdź, czy znajduje się poprawny tekst.

    Zrzut ekranu przedstawiający okienko loclabel narzędzia do sprawdzania poleceń.

Sprawdzanie warstw rozwiązania

Jeśli w rozwiązaniu znajduje się poprawny element LocLabel, mogą istnieć inne rozwiązania, które go zastępują. Wyświetl warstwy rozwiązania etykiet i sprawdź, czy wyższe rozwiązanie zdefiniowało to samo locLabel.

Sprawdź, czy identyfikatory etykiet pasują dokładnie do wielkości liter

Identyfikatory etykiet są wrażliwe na wielkość liter podczas dopasowywania identyfikatorów w pliku XML wstążki do zlokalizowanych wartości etykiet. Kontrolka LabelText przycisku powinna zawierać prawidłowe odwołanie LocLabel, które dokładnie odpowiada wielkości liter identyfikatora rekordu LocLabel.

Odwołanie

Moduł sprawdzania poleceń dla wstążek aplikacji opartych na modelu